VetNet Scores with Orange County Soccer Club Partnership!

We are excited to announce the kick-off of a new partnership between the Working Wardrobes VetNet Program, the Orange County Soccer Club (OCSC), and the Embassy of the State of Qatar to the United States!

The partnership is part of the State of Qatar’s ongoing commitment to the U.S. military and its families. It launches a series of new programming led by the OCSC Foundation, with support from the Embassy, which is designed to celebrate and support active-duty military, veterans, and their families in Southern California.

We’re so pleased that the OCSC and the Embassy of the State of Qatar to the United States will be contributing sponsors for our Working Wardrobes VetNet Program Power Up for Success event at Camp Pendleton this October.

This important, transformational event provides 150 active-duty service members with tools and resources to support their professional success as they get ready to make the transition to civilian life.  The day includes a variety of services, such as confidence-building exercises and empowerment, an employer panel, workshops, and professional wardrobe selection.

July 17th was OCSC’s Military Appreciation Night.  VetNet Director, Michael Barrett, and Lisa Keston, Executive Director of OCSC Community Foundation were invited on the field for a presentation to the Deputy Consul General of the Embassy of the State of Qatar to the United States.
